http://www.fabg-dallas.com/suomi103 In a nutshell, Finland has been ruled by Sweden and Russia before it became independent. From the medieval times to the early 19th century, Finland was a part of Sweden. The Swedes’ war against Napoleon didn’t go too well and Russia invaded Finland in 1808. December 6 is a day held to commemorate Finland’s declaration of independence from the Russian Empire when the Bolsheviks took power in late 1917. This year, the day will be observed on Tuesday, …

WebJun 29, 2024 · Finnish Independence Day features fewer large-scale events and instead focuses on commemorating the day on local and individual levels. The blue and white colors of the flag are displayed in shop windows and used as icing on baked goods. In a more subtle tradition, families light two candles and place them in the windows of their homes.
